Overview
BlockShow Asia is a leading blockchain conference that brings together industry experts, investors, and entrepreneurs to discuss the latest trends and innovations in the blockchain space. The conference features keynote speeches, panel discussions, and networking opportunities, providing a platform for attendees to learn, connect, and grow. With a focus on the Asian market, BlockShow Asia has become a hub for blockchain enthusiasts and professionals to explore the vast potential of blockchain technology.
🌐 Origins & History
BlockShow Asia was first launched in 2017 by Addittya Sharma and Nickolay Zhuravlev, co-founders of BlockShow. The conference was initially held in Singapore and has since become an annual event, attracting thousands of attendees from around the world. The conference has featured keynote speeches from industry leaders such as Vitalik Buterin, Charlie Lee, and Tim Draper.
